Where are the bars and restaurants?
Portuguese like to go to a bar for a 'bica' (a coffee) or a 'cerveza' (a beer),
so every little village has at least 1 bar. They are definitely not the bars
we are used to in Northern Europe, as you will always find a television on and
bright lights! More civilized (Northern European standards) bars and restaurants
can be found at the coast, in places like Albufeira and Carvoeiro. Also Silves
(close to our villas) has a wide range of bars and restaurants. We recommend
Cafe Ingles for non Portuguese food. They do nice live music as well.
There are various local restaurants near all the villas were you can eat chicken
piri piri, or fresh fish like the Sardines, Dourada (sea bream), etc.

What is the climate like?
The Algarve is well known for its fine climate, with over 300 days of sunshine a year. The summers are hot, but generally there is a nice breeze to cool you down. Spring and autumn can be very warm, but a rain shower once in while could be possible.
The winters are mild, some days are cloudy with some rain, but very often the sun shines and during the day it can be very warm. The nights can be cold though!
Does it look dry and horrible because of the drought?
Fortunately not! The famous red soil here is very fertile. All year it is pretty green here, although winter and spring are greener. All year-round there is always something blooming, like in January and February the white almond blossom, followed by all sorts of flowers in various colors like poppy's, . The orange blossom starts in March and smells so fantastic you always want to keep it with you!
